What an amazing property... From the stunning mountain views, to the fantastic layout and opportunity to finish the basement as you desire. This all brick, main level living home is set on a gently rolling 1.26 acres . Great for play opportunities!! The interior is gorgeous with hardwood and tile floors throughout the house. 2 story high ceilings welcome you home as you enter the foyer. The family room has built-ins, high ceilings and is open to the kitchen and breakfast area. French doors lead you to the sunroom with panoramic views of the smokies. Split bedrooms offer privacy and personal space for everyone in the house. The kitchen has stainless appliances and dark wood cabinets, massive pantry allows for all the kitchen toys you desire. The master bedroom and bath have high ceilings and a walk-in shower and a large whirlpool tub. To the front of the house, a true formal dining room for all your gatherings!! There is a bonus room that is perfect for play room, or TV room. The sweet spot in this house is the basement. It is partially finished. It is plumbed for another bathroom and laundry. Even after finishing the bedroom and rec room, you and still have tons of storage. The basement also has a 528 square foot 3rd garage for equipment or work shop. This square footage is not included in the 2077 basement square footage.
